One of the factors leading to high maternal mortality rate and infant mortality rate in Indonesia is the incidence of abortion . This study examines the risk factors what causes abortion incidence in pregnant women at Dr M.Djamil Padang Hospital . Research methods to approach cross-sectional descriptive analytic study . Total population of 125 people and is set as a sample in accordance with the criteria of only 52 respondents with a univariate analysis of the frequency distribution techniques and bivariate analysis with the Chi - Square formula . The results showed the incidence of abortion in Dr . M.Djamil Padang Hospital occurs more frequently in women who had one abortion, namely : 84.6 % ( 44 persons ) , while women with the incidence of abortion more than once only 15.4 % ( 8 people ) . And for occupational factors and factors associated with hemoglobin levels if the incidence of abortion showed a significant result that the work factor and the factor p = 0.000 hb levels p = 0.001. As for age, parity factor , Medical history factor and distance factors with previous pregnancies showed no significant results . Need an effort to further examine other factors that may contribute to the incidence of abortion in the mother.
